When the parking brakes are released manually, the machine has no brakes.To avoid possible personal injury, the tires must be blocked securely before the parking brakes are manually released.
The parking brake can be released manually when insufficient pressure in the braking system prevents the parking brake from being released with the parking brake control.The machine must be parked on a level surface before the parking brake is manually released.
Block the wheels in order to prevent the machine from moving when the parking brake is released.
Install the steering frame lock. Refer to Operation and Maintenance Manual, "Steering Frame Lock".
Illustration 1 g00948834
Raise the truck body or the OEM attachment in order to access the parking brake actuator. If the truck body or the OEM attachment cannot be raised, access to the parking brake actuator can be gained from a position underneath the machine.Note: Install the truck body or the OEM attachments prop if the truck body or the OEM attachment is raised.
Illustration 2 g01130524
Loosen rod (2) which is connected to yoke (1). Rotate rod (2) clockwise. This allows a parking brake lever to move. This relieves the pressure from the brake pads.Rotate the shaft until the brake pads do not contact disc (1) and the parking brake has been released.Adjusting the Parking Brake
Note: The machine must be fully operational before the parking brake can be set.
Raise the truck body or the OEM attachment enough to lift the truck body or the OEM attachments prop and then move the hoist control to the HOLD position.
Lift the truck body or the OEM attachments prop.
Move the hoist control to the FLOAT position. This will allow the truck body or the OEM attachment to lower slowly until the weight of the truck body or the OEM attachment is supported by the truck body or the OEM attachments prop.
Fully screw rod (2) onto yoke (1) .
Start the engine and move the parking brake control to the DISENGAGED position.
Illustration 3 g01130535
Remove plug (4) and the gasket. Insert a 6mm hexagonal drive into the hole and rotate the hexagonal drive clockwise until resistance is felt. The gap between the brake pads and the disc should now be zero.
To set the initial running clearance, rotate the hexagonal drive counterclockwise. You will feel a click on the hexagonal drive. Rotate the hexagonal drive for eight clicks.
Use a feeler gauge to check the gaps between the brake pads and the disc. The total running clearance between the disc and the brake pads should be 1.15 0.15 mm (0.045 0.006 inch).
If the running clearance is incorrect, increase or reduce the number of clicks. Refer to steps 6 through 8.
Install plug (4) and the gasket. Tighten the plug to a torque of 14 3 N m (10 2 lb ft).
Move the parking brake control to the ENGAGED position. Lower the truck body or the OEM attachment and shut off the engine.
Remove the blocks from the wheels and then remove the steering frame lock.
